Jaguars sign wide receiver Jeremy Ebert, waive defensive tackle Jeris Pendleton

JACKSONVILLE, Florida — The Jaguars have signed first-year receiver Jeremy Ebert and waived defensive tackle Jeris Pendleton.

Ebert was a seventh-round draft pick by New England Patriots in 2012. He also spent time on Philadelphia's practice squad last season. He re-signed with the Patriots on Jan. 21 and was waived April 29.

Ebert had 173 receptions for 2,400 yards and 21 touchdowns at Northwestern. He led the team in receiving his final two seasons, including 75 catches for 1,060 yards and 11 touchdowns as a senior.

The 29-year-old Pendleton had been a long shot to make Jacksonville's roster even though he was a seventh-round pick in 2012. The rebuilding Jaguars are looking to get younger at every position, making it hard to keep an inexperienced backup who will turn 30 during the season.
